Technical Advantages That Matter
Unlike modified sine wave alternatives, 48V pure sine wave inverters deliver:
| Feature | Benefit | Industry Impact |
|---|---|---|
| THD <3% | Safe for sensitive electronics | Reduces equipment failure rates |
| IP65 Protection | Weather-resistant operation | Enables outdoor installations |

Industry Outlook: What's Next?
The convergence of three trends is driving demand:
- Global shift to 48V architecture in energy storage
- Rising adoption of lithium battery systems
- Smart grid integration requirements
